On Thu, Sep 19, 2013 at 11:56 AM, SHREYAS JOSHI <dexterous.m...@yahoo.com> wrote: > I have a prebuilt - WIN7 on my laptop. I selected the backup option and > created the backup image and bootable disk of WIN7. > Now, I want to run that image on the Virtual box, how can I do it?
I believe that what you created is not a bootable image of your running desktop, but rather a bootable disk with a RESTORE PROGRAM to restore your backup. In any case, I think you could create a new virtualbox VM, make it Win7, and before the first boot, make sure you have the bootable disk mounted into the Virtualbox VM. It is not clear from your post whether you have burned the boot CD to a real (physical) CD-R o DVD-R, and where is your system backup stored (internal hard drive, external HD? pen drive?).
